Loot A novel by Tania James is a historical fiction work published by Knopf Doubleday Publishing Group on June 13, 2023. This 304-page book is written in English and presents a narrative set in the eighteenth century, following a young artist named Abbas as he embarks on a quest that intertwines themes of cultural heritage and the impacts of colonialism across two continents.
Readers will find a richly woven tale that combines a hero’s journey, a love story, and an adventurous heist. As Abbas, a talented woodcarver, becomes involved with Tipu Sultan and the creation of a giant tiger automaton, he navigates the complexities of war, displacement, and emigration. The story unfolds as Abbas travels to Europe, seeking to reclaim the lost tiger from an estate in the English countryside, reflecting the broader historical context of the time.

Abbas is just seventeen years old when his gifts as a woodcarver come to the attention of Tipu Sultan, and he is drawn into service at the palace in order to build a giant tiger automaton for Tipu’s sons, a gift to commemorate their return from British captivity. His fate—and the fate of the wooden tiger he helps create—will mirror the vicissitudes of nations and dynasties ravaged by war across India and Europe.
Working alongside the legendary French clockmaker Lucien du Leze, Abbas hones his craft, learns French, and meets Jehanne, the daughter of a French expatriate. When Du Leze is finally permitted to return home to Rouen, he invites Abbas to come along as his apprentice. But by the time Abbas travels to Europe, Tipu’s palace has been looted by British forces, and the tiger automaton has disappeared. To prove himself, Abbas must retrieve the tiger from an estate in the English countryside, where it is displayed in a collection of plundered art.
